GOL to Expand B737 MAX Fleet with Three New Deliveries

GOL Linhas Aéreas (Brazil) is set to strengthen its fleet with the addition of three new Boeing B737 MAX aircraft, identified by serials 44032, 44025, and 44033. These aircraft are being delivered directly from the Boeing manufacturing facilities in the United States, increasing GOL’s MAX fleet to 52 aircraft.

Asman Airlines Plans Airbus Leases for European Routes

Asman Airlines (Kyrgyzstan) has unveiled plans to lease two Airbus aircraft—either A320s or A321s—in 2025 to support its ambitions for launching routes to Europe. This initiative is contingent on the airline’s removal from the EU Air Safety List, a prerequisite for operating within European airspace.

AirSial Expands Fleet with New Leased Aircraft

AirSial (Pakistan) is enhancing its operations with the acquisition of additional aircraft to meet its growing demand. The airline has signed an agreement to lease two Airbus A320s from AerCap (Ireland), which will increase the carrier’s fleet to nine aircraft upon delivery. These additions are part of AirSial’s strategy to strengthen its capacity and network.
